Here are a number of things that have occurred in or through Roblox. It doesn't cover everything, but I wanted to list enough to drive it home and increase your awareness:
• Grooming of children by adult predators via in-game chat
• Solicitation of minors to share inappropriate images
• Use of Robux (in-game currency) to lure children into private chats
• Predators directing children to third-party apps like Discord and Snapchat
• Extortion of children using AI-generated explicit images
• Attempted physical meetups arranged through Roblox messaging
• A 12-year-old girl abducted by a known predator active on Roblox
• A 10-year-old manipulated into harming an infant after receiving violent instructions via Roblox chat
• Multiple lawsuits filed by families alleging Roblox failed to protect minors
• Creation of inappropriate games with sexual or violent themes
• Use of deceptive game titles to bypass moderation filters
• Children exposed to gambling mechanics disguised as mini-games
• Predators using voice chat to bypass text filters
• Roblox’s delayed implementation of grooming detection tools (not until 2022)
• Alleged exploitation of child developers with little financial compensation
• A predator continued contacting a child even after arrest and court orders
• Manipulation of children into sending money or gift cards
